Hot Tub Disposal in Madison, WI
Hot tub disposal services involve the removal and proper disposal of old, broken, or unwanted hot tubs from residential properties. These projects typically include dismantling the hot tub, safely handling electrical and plumbing components, and transporting the debris to appropriate disposal facilities. Homeowners often request this service when upgrading to a new hot tub, clearing space in a backyard, or dealing with a unit that is no longer functional or safe to operate.
Before requesting hot tub disposal, property owners should consider the size and location of the hot tub, as well as any potential access restrictions on the property. It’s also helpful to understand whether the hot tub contains any hazardous materials or electrical components that require special handling. Clarifying these details can ensure the disposal process proceeds smoothly and safely, minimizing disruption and ensuring proper removal of the entire unit.

Hot Tub Disposal Questions
What is involved in hot tub disposal? Hot tub disposal typically includes draining, disconnecting, and breaking down the unit for removal from the property.
Are there any restrictions on disposing of a hot tub? Disposal may be limited by local regulations or the condition of the hot tub, especially if it contains hazardous materials or large components.
Can hot tubs be recycled during disposal? Many parts of a hot tub, such as metal and plastic components, can be recycled as part of the disposal process.
What should property owners know before disposing of a hot tub? It’s important to prepare the site for removal and check for any specific local disposal guidelines or restrictions.
